DO NOT BUY - BEWARE - WRONGLY LISTED AS CERAMIC I’m seeing way too many people list fossil watches as ceramic, when they are actually resin, aluminum, or stainless steel. This pink one in pic for instance, is not ceramic. Ceramic is highly lustrous and is going to have more substance than the other materials. If you’re looking for ceramic make sure you get the model number and or look at the sides of the watch. Ceramic watches will have tiny screws on the links. Other materials will not have screw, they will have pins (exception is the ones with links you can remove yourself without a tool such as the Jesse ceramic).

boingo82 thank you, also ceramic will often be cold to the touch, heavy, and sound like a Corelle plate when tapped. also, for Fossil watches, the ceramic model numbers almost always start with "CE". if your watch is ES####, it's not ceramic!
